Output e99a76f8d80c8ade23afbc8dae6004a6fef5adbbdfce859178c2eed83f306ec9:1

value
516741588
script pubkey
OP_0 OP_PUSHBYTES_20 62e1d76334e8e0ba7c6f4d7201bbbd6cfc0fccaf
address
bc1qvtsawce5arst5lr0f4eqrwaadn7qln90whdjgz
transaction
e99a76f8d80c8ade23afbc8dae6004a6fef5adbbdfce859178c2eed83f306ec9
confirmations
303827
spent
true